Honolulu Marathon

I didn’t really train this year (i.e. no long runs at all), but I signed up for an entry in January when they had the really cheap bib numbers for us kama’aina. I decided to try to run 8 min miles for as long as I could. I decided to not start at the front this year, since I wasn’t going to run fast. Boy was that a mistake. The worst part was the gigantic group of Japanese students who stopped, 15 abreast, ten feet after the start line to take pictures of the fireworks. Then there were thousands of 6hr folks in the “2 to 3 hour” corral just dropping anchor for the first mile. After that though, it was fun despite the headwinds and driving rain. I’d rather have that than heat any day. On these out-and-back routes with a headwind, I always look forward to the turnaround, but then Wind Jesus always seems to turn off the wind right when I head back the other way. I felt good until about 22, and the push up diamond head was really painful. I ran a bit faster than last year off much less training, so I guess that’s a good thing.
